It might be difficult to imagine fine dining Indian cuisine but Jasmin has managed. The food feels very authentic (as far as I can tell). Spicy food fans will have tears in their eyes from their Chicken Tindaloo, described as the curry for people who find Vindaloo mild.

Ate here with my wife Saturday night, in the small upstairs dining room. Not as busy as usual but the food and service was as good as ever. The mixed entrees are superb, probably the best samosas this side of Jaipur. Main dishes of vegetable thali and bhoona ghosht complemented each other superbly and the overall ambience of the place is very civilised with unobtrusive music in the background.
If you're into Indian food and live anywhere near Adelaide then you're fortunate. If you're not a fan of this cuisine, give it a try here, you may well be converted!
